Capital One Brings Back 100K Welcome Offer for Venture X Card
by Kyle Burbank
Just in time for the holiday shopping season, Capital One is boasting an enhanced welcome offer for one of its most popular rewards cards. About the Venture X Welcome Bonus Offer: For the first time since the Capital One Venture X launched in 2021, the card is offering a six-figure welcome bonus. Currently, new cardholders can earn 100,000 bonus miles after spending $10,000 or more on the card within their...

Bilt Lays Out Timeline, First Migration Details for Bilt 2.0 Launch
by Kyle Burbank
As Bilt Rewards prepares for big changes next year, the platform has shared more details about the launch of Bilt 2.0 with members. About the Bilt 2.0 Migration and Timeline: It's full steam ahead to Bilt 2.0. Today, Bilt alerted members that the official conversion would occur on February 7th, 2026. On that date, the Bilt Mastercard will move from Wells Fargo to Cardless. However, ahead of that, the company...
